A new vacation home in Georgia gets an earthy, organic farmhouse feel perfectly suited for large family gatherings.
Can a home design be too good to be true?
A few years ago, interior design mother-daughter team Beth Meyer and Abby McLane helped an empty-nest couple design and build a second home in Georgia. “It was before Covid, and then during Covid lots of people from California were moving here,” Beth says. "A couple came and asked [my clients] if they'd like to sell. They'd only been there a year, but they said sure. So they bought it totally furnished.” Beth's clients still wanted a second home as a gathering space for family, so they approached Beth again. This house is the result.
FULLY FUNCTIONAL
They started with a large lot in a community outside Atlanta. But the couple didn't want the house itself to be massive. "Their last vacation house was larger, but they didn't want a huge main house for this one," Beth says. The house is very spacious, and the couple has plans to add several outbuildings to the property, including a guest structure and recreation house. "This community likes to do that, it's like a homestead," Beth says.
Having built one vacation home already, the couple could narrow down exactly what they wanted for functionality."This is where the family gathers for holidays," Beth says. The communal spaces are larger, with the expectation that the family will spend most of their time at the house together.
